Description
The UAVI_UAA data suite provides the Ultraviolet Absorbing Aerosol Index (UVAI) calculated using the Unified Aerosol Algorithm. UVAI is a unitless, semi-quantitative indicator of light-absorbing aerosols (e.g., smoke, mineral dust), sensitive to their amount, altitude, and absorption strength; positive values typically flag absorbing plumes, while values near/below zero indicate weakly or non-absorbing conditions. Common uses include plume detection and tracking, air-quality and climate analyses, and providing aerosol context for ocean-color atmospheric correction; users should apply recommended screening in the file attributes.
Core geophysical variables in this suite include:
- NUV_AerosolIndex — Near-UV aerosol index from 0.354/0.388 µm pair (unitless)
- NUV_Reflectivity — Near-UV Lambertian equivalent reflectance (LER) at 0.354 and 0.388 µm (unitless)
- NUV_Residue — Near-UV LER-based aerosol index from 0.354/0.388 µm pair (unitless)
